Travel Tips for Dining Alone on Your Business Trip

pittbsurgh limo serviceIf you travel for business, more than likely you spend your fair share of time eating out alone. While some people are comfortable with this type of situation, most are not. The good news is that you have options to make dining alone while on a business trip easier.

Travel Tips for Dining Alone

  • Conduct Research – Before heading out on your next business trip, spend a little time conducting research online on restaurants. In particular, look for restaurants that cater to businesspeople. With this, there is a good chance that you will not be the only person dining alone. 

  • Be Productive – Instead of sitting awkwardly alone at the table, use this alone time to be productive. For instance, you can take a cellphone or tablet to run reports, do research, catch up on meeting minutes, schedule appointments, answer emails, and more. If you have no business to catch up on, your mobile devices are great for playing games, reading articles, and listening to music with an earbud.

  • Take a Cuisine Adventure – Look at your time dining alone as an adventure. The best way to accomplish this is by choosing a restaurant known for serving a regional specialty. You might even ask to speak to the chef to learn more about the dish and restaurant itself.

  • Be Confident – Although you might be tempted, do not let what other people do affect you when dining alone on a business trip. After all, other patrons do not know you or anything about you, so enjoy your meal with complete confidence. In fact, this is the perfect opportunity to do a little bit of people watching of your own.

  • Choose a Bar Seat – For extremely busy restaurants or if you do feel uncomfortable, you can always choose a bar seat as opposed to a dining room table. You will find that many businesspeople do this because it offers more privacy, comfort, and the chance to visit with other people.

  • Get Food to Go – If you have your heart set on trying food from one particular restaurant, call ahead and get your order to go. That way, you still get to enjoy an amazing meal without the awkwardness of sitting alone in the restaurant.
